Air France-KLM Transportation 78399 $36.5B France Google Google Cloud Vertex AI Generative AI Platforms 2024 n/a
In 2024, Air France-KLM deployed Google Cloud Vertex AI as a centerpiece of its Generative AI Platforms initiative to accelerate a data centric, multicloud strategy across the airline group. The program targets commercial, cargo, engineering and maintenance operations that generate high volumes of telemetry and customer data from 551 operating aircraft and 93 million passengers carried in 2023, and it aligns Google Cloud Vertex AI with the group’s move to cloud native analytics and lower latency processing. The implementation centers on a common data lakehouse and BigQuery based analytics fabric feeding Google Cloud Vertex AI for model training and inference, with a dedicated secured generative AI cloud instance provisioned for Air France-KLM. Functional capabilities explicitly scoped include multimodal generative AI modeling, customer agent automation with automatic documentation, and predictive aircraft maintenance workflows, all consistent with Generative AI Platforms functional patterns. Integrations described in the engagement include BigQuery as the analytics backbone and a multicloud architecture to host applications and data workflows, enabling ultra low latency access to models and data while preserving enterprise data ownership and control. Operational coverage spans product teams, data science and engineering, security and infrastructure groups, and frontline customer service and maintenance operations, supporting both internal and external facing use cases. Governance and rollout include training and support programs, hackathon style events, and a mix of on site and online training to democratize data and gen AI skills across Air France-KLM teams. Outcomes called out by the collaboration include faster time to market and reduced data processing latency, with predictive maintenance analysis time already falling from hours to minutes, and an explicit aim to improve customer personalization and reduce environmental impact.
Akeneo Professional Services 400 $58M France Google Google Cloud Vertex AI Generative AI Platforms 2024 n/a
In 2024 Akeneo implemented Google Cloud Vertex AI as part of a strategy to reinvent product experience, leveraging the Generative AI Platforms capabilities of Vertex AI and large language models like Gemini. The deployment centers on embedding Google Cloud Vertex AI into Akeneo Product Cloud and integrating Unifai capabilities to accelerate AI-driven product information workflows across manufacturers, brands, retailers and customers. The implementation configures Google Cloud Vertex AI to generate multilingual product descriptions, ingest and enrich streams of images and videos, and support real-time data augmentation and adaptation to local cultural specificities. Functional capabilities emphasized include LLM powered content generation, media enrichment pipelines, and continuous model-driven product information enhancement, all consistent with Generative AI Platforms functional workflows. Architecturally the work ties Unifai into Akeneo Product Cloud while using Google Cloud Vertex AI as the cloud hosted inference and model management layer, with data pipelines feeding product content, multimedia assets, and localization metadata into Vertex AI models. The design prioritizes managed model lifecycle, online data updates to complement training data, and content delivery to multiple commerce channels via Akeneo Product Cloud. Governance and operationalization include the creation of an Akeneo AI center of excellence to codify best practices, run training sessions and webinars, and publish white papers and case studies to support adoption. The initiative explicitly aims to sharpen competitive advantage through greater innovation and cost optimization and to enhance the customer purchasing journey by improving product information quality and relevance, while impacting product information management, merchandising and e commerce functions.
Apollo Hospitals Healthcare 82786 $2.6B India Google Google Cloud Vertex AI Generative AI Platforms 2023 n/a
In 2023, Apollo Hospitals expanded its partnership with Google Cloud in Bengaluru, India to deploy Google Cloud Vertex AI within its Apollo 24|7 platform, using Generative AI Platforms to extend telemedicine, online consultations, home delivery of medication, and clinician decision support across its nationwide healthcare network. The announcement frames Google Cloud Vertex AI as a core component of Apollo 24|7, India’s largest and fastest growing health platform, positioned to deliver an omnichannel healthcare experience that spans patient facing services and clinical workflows. Apollo Hospitals and Google Cloud jointly developed a Clinical Intelligence Engine abbreviated as CIE, built with Google Cloud Vertex AI and large language models to provide AI powered clinical decision support that identifies next best actions for clinicians during consultations. The implementation also includes AskApollo, a patient facing care navigation service built on top of the CIE, and the team is exploring Med PaLM 2 for medical question answering and clinical text summarization, reflecting a Generative AI Platforms approach to both clinician and patient interactions. The technical footprint was deployed on Google Cloud using a microservices architecture, with Apollo 24|7 engineering teams and partner Searce deploying 78 microservices and over 40 databases with zero downtime, and with the Apollo 24|7 data lake implemented on Google BigQuery to consolidate siloed data. Google Cloud Vertex AI is used in concert with BigQuery and Google’s LLMs, and the service design keeps all patient data securely within Apollo Hospitals systems while leveraging cloud compute and model hosting for inference and model lifecycle management. Governance and operational controls were emphasized as part of the rollout, Google Cloud’s data governance and privacy practices are applied, and model monitoring, output review, safety guardrails, and documentation are used to support responsible use of generative models in clinical contexts. The program explicitly targets improved access to timely and accurate health information, enhanced clinician decision making, and scalable delivery of care navigation and telemedicine services through the Apollo 24|7 platform.
AssemblyAI Professional Services 120 $12M United States Google Google Cloud Vertex AI Generative AI Platforms 2025 n/a
In 2025, AssemblyAI implemented Google Cloud Vertex AI within its Generative AI Platforms stack to support next-generation speech-to-text and speech understanding model development. The project addressed exponential data growth and compute needs as research models expanded from roughly 1.1 million hours of audio to more than 12 million hours, and storage requirements grew from hundreds of terabytes to over 1 petabyte. The deployment centralized an AI lake house on Google Cloud, leveraging Google Cloud Storage, BigQuery, and Bigtable for petabyte-scale structured and unstructured data management, and Looker for visualization. AssemblyAI provisioned training infrastructure on Google Cloud using Vertex AI and tensor processing units for model training, while Kubernetes-based orchestration and Cloud Composer were configured to prepare and pipeline large volumes of audio for parallelized training and evaluation. Operational integrations include Google Kubernetes Engine for container orchestration, Dataproc and Dataflow for large-scale data processing jobs, Cloud Composer for workflow orchestration, and Vertex AI for model evaluation and training orchestration. The configuration enabled on-demand scaling to thousands of nodes and GPUs or TPUs, supporting concurrent experiments and reducing bottlenecks that previously constrained research throughput. Governance and process changes focused on researcher autonomy and data lineage, reducing engineering handoffs by providing researchers with self-service pipeline patterns via Cloud Composer and Kubernetes. AssemblyAI also instrumented audit, logging, and data lineage capabilities available in Google Cloud to track which datasets trained specific models, supporting compliance with data privacy and ownership requirements. Explicit outcomes stated by AssemblyAI include a 75% reduction in data storage and infrastructure costs, a decrease in model evaluation time from 24 hours to about 20 minutes using Vertex AI, and an increase in data processing capacity and storage by more than 10 times, enabling training on billions-parameter models with pods of TPUs. The move accelerated model development cycles, including release of the Universal-2 model in under six months after the cloud implementation, and AssemblyAI cites ongoing operational support from the Google Cloud team for experiment ramp and troubleshooting.
Avathon Professional Services 251 $35M United States Google Google Cloud Vertex AI Generative AI Platforms 2025 n/a
In 2025, Avathon expanded its collaboration with Google Cloud by embedding Google Cloud Vertex AI into its Autonomy Platform within the Generative AI Platforms category. This integration advances Avathon Autonomy for Energy Operations, a unified AI solution designed to connect data, decisions, and execution across oil and gas, utilities, and renewable energy providers. The implementation configures functional modules for AI powered asset management, supply chain orchestration, anomaly detection, predictive maintenance, and energy forecasting. Google Cloud Vertex AI is used to enhance machine learning model training and inference for greater precision in anomaly detection and forecasting, while Gemini Enterprise is employed to create intelligent operational agents that automate complex workflows and deliver on demand operational insights. Architecturally the deployment leverages Google Cloud scalable infrastructure to unify disparate software systems and asset data into a single operational plane, enabling real time insights, predictive analytics, and prescriptive recommendations. The integrated platform explicitly covers geographically distributed energy assets including compressor stations, pipelines, conventional power plants, wind turbines, solar inverters, and battery energy storage systems, and it aligns operational data flows between asset management and supply chain capabilities. Governance and operational change emphasize operationalizing data driven decision making and enabling autonomous, semi autonomous, and adaptive processes and actions across operations, maintenance, supply chain, and field safety functions. Avathon Autonomy for Energy Operations, powered by Google Cloud Vertex AI and Gemini Enterprise, is positioned to optimize energy production, minimize downtime, extend asset lifespan, improve yields, reduce operational costs, enhance safety, and strengthen compliance readiness for energy providers.
